    Just as is the case with power supplies, comparing LCDs by spec alone is futile.
    Unless you can determine that the manufacturers are using the exact same test, the resulting numbers are apples to oranges.
    My acquaintances who game have (begrudgingly) begun to convert to LCDs and seem satisfied, but you still have to spend some serious cash to approach CRT performance...the cheap ones don't have the necessary response time and contrast (which I believe is the "700:1" you refer to).

    Just as with speakers/sound systems, only you can determine what is "good", "better" and "OMFG!"
